## Service Accounts — StormFan Alert Fan-Out

The fan-out worker authenticates to the internal dispatch tier using the svc-stormfan account. Rotate quarterly; scopes are limited to publish-only on alert topics. If deliveries stall during your shift, verify the worker is using the current credential, reproduced below for reference.

API key for kaweg-hahif: kto4_rAjZ

**Deploy step 6 — Kelpgrid Transcode Farm**

Alright, once the worker images are baked, push them to the farm's staging ring before touching prod. The orchestrator won't schedule anything unsigned, and yes, it's picky after last month's incident. Double-check the manifest hash matches the build log. When the signer prompts you, use the current farm deploy key, which is this.

rollout seal: bky4_x7Gc

Deploy step 4 — SeatGlyph renderer (Orpheum Vale theatre). Build the canvas bundle, run the seat-map snapshot suite, confirm zero layout drift against the Velvet Row fixture. Push to the staging CDN, verify pricing tiers render in the balcony overlay, then tag the release. No manual QA needed unless the mezzanine polygon count changed. Rollback is a single CDN pointer flip. Before promoting to prod, sign the artifact with the key below.

release key, kawif-hawep: bky13_X7TGuRG4Zu4ZJ

Briefing — Leadership Review: Project Larkspine Delay

Finance team: Larkspine slips two quarters. Causes: vendor integration failures, understaffed test phase. Cost impact: roughly 9% over budget, absorbed within the Meridel division envelope for now. Mitigation: scope cut to core modules; contractor spend frozen. Revised milestones circulate Monday. Decision required on contingency release at the review. The confidential planning note appears below.

board note of tawip-hahip: Only 7 of the 80 pilot accounts renewed Ralath, so a churn review is set for April 1.